Milan Kangrga (born May 1, 1923 in Zagreb ; † April 25, 2008 ibid) was Professor of Philosophy at the University of Zagreb .

Life

Kangrga studied philosophy at the University of Zagreb and received his doctorate in 1961, and from 1962 to 1964 he had a study visit at the University of Heidelberg made possible by the Alexander von Humboldt Foundation . He later worked as a guest lecturer at the universities of Bonn and Düsseldorf and several universities in the Soviet Union and Czechoslovakia. From 1972 he was a full professor of philosophy (chair of ethics) at the University of Zagreb, and in 1993 he retired . He was one of the founding members of the practice group . He was involved in the Socijalistička radnička partija Hrvatske (Croatian Socialist Workers' Party) founded in 1997 .

Works

  • Rationalistička filozofija , 1957 (= Rationalist Philosophy)
  • Etički problem u djelu Karla Marxa , 1963 (2nd edition 1980) (= The ethical problem in the work of Karl Marx )
  • Etika i sloboda , 1966 (= ethics and freedom)
  • The meaning of Marxian philosophy and practice and criticism. Reflections on Marx's " Theses on Feuerbach " , in: Revolutionäre Praxis, ed. v. Gajo Petrović , 1969
  • Smisao povijesnoga , 1970 (= The sense of history)
  • Razmišljanja o etici , 1970 (= thoughts on ethics)
  • Alienation and reification in Marx's work , in: Yugoslavia thinks differently , 1971 ( ISBN 3-203-50242-2 )
  • Izvan povijesnog događanja , 1997 ( ISBN 953-6359-20-0 ) (= outside of historical events)
  • Praksa - vrijeme - svijet (German edition: Praxis - Zeit - Welt , 2004, ISBN 3-8260-2759-0 )
  • We wanted a democratic solution for the socialist movement (interview) in: »1968« in Yugoslavia. Student protests and cultural avant-garde between 1960 and 1975. Conversations and documents , ed. by Boris Kanzleiter and Krunoslav Stojaković, 2008 ( ISBN 978-3-8012-4179-7 ), pp. 125-137
